ES6引入了一种新的原始数据类型Symbol,表示独一无二的值
Symbol 值通过Symbol函数生成
let s = Symbol();
Symbol函数可以接受一个字符串作为参数,表示对Symbol实例的描述
需要注意的是,相同参数的Symbol函数的返回值也是不相等的
那如果要让他们相等怎么办,其实它提供了一个方法,下面图中会讲到
为了方便查看,我将相关内容汇总为一图:

Symbol.png
如有问题,欢迎留言告知~
ES6引入了一种新的原始数据类型Symbol,表示独一无二的值
Symbol 值通过Symbol函数生成
let s = Symbol();
Symbol函数可以接受一个字符串作为参数,表示对Symbol实例的描述
需要注意的是,相同参数的Symbol函数的返回值也是不相等的
那如果要让他们相等怎么办,其实它提供了一个方法,下面图中会讲到
为了方便查看,我将相关内容汇总为一图:
如有问题,欢迎留言告知~